首页 >数据库 >mysql教程 >如何修复 Snow Leopard 上的 Rails 和 MySQL 兼容性问题?

如何修复 Snow Leopard 上的 Rails 和 MySQL 兼容性问题?

Barbara Streisand
Barbara Streisand原创
2024-11-26 17:40:09489浏览

How to Fix Rails and MySQL Compatibility Issues on Snow Leopard?

Snow Leopard 上的 Rails 和 MySQL:正确使用

升级到 Snow Leopard 后,由于运行 Rails 应用程序而遇到困难并不罕见捆绑的 MySQL.rb 驱动程序的问题。要解决此问题,请按照以下步骤操作:

  1. 安装 MySQL gem:

    sudo env ARCHFLAGS="-arch x86_64" gem install mysql -- --with-mysql-config=/usr/local/mysql/bin/mysql_config
  2. 从以前的安装中卸载任何现有的 MySQL gem 以避免冲突。

如果您在 MySQL gem 安装过程中遇到定位 libmysqlclient.16.dylib 的问题,确保指定 mysql_config 的正确路径非常重要。以下步骤可以提供帮助:

  1. 从 mysql.com 下载适合 Snow Leopard 的 MySQL 版本(5.1.37 64 位)。
  2. 确保 mysql_config 在 /usr 中可用/local/mysql/bin/mysql_config.
  3. 更新 gem system:

    sudo gem update --system
  4. 运行以下命令:

    sudo env ARCHFLAGS="-arch x86_64" gem install mysql -- --with-mysql-config=/usr/local/mysql/bin/mysql_config

按照以下步骤,您可以确保 Rails 和 MySQL在您的 Snow Leopard 安装上正确配置,使您能够无错误地运行应用程序。

以上是如何修复 Snow Leopard 上的 Rails 和 MySQL 兼容性问题?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n